Ghana safest country in West Africa – Akufo-Addo

 

President Nana Addo Dankwa Akufo-Addo has described Ghana as the safest country in the West African region.

According to the President, “In today’s world, where sadly crime and terror have become part of everyday life, I can say that Ghana is certainly the safest country in the West African region, and remains one of the few places on earth where we are not embarrassed to see ourselves as each other’s keeper”.

The comments were posted on the official Twitter handle of President Akufo-Addo on Thursday.

The President is currently on a tour of Guyana, St Vincent and the Grenadines, Trinidad and Tobago, Barbados and Jamaica.
